E.2 Objective of the trial |
E.2.1 | Main objective of the trial |
The objective of the current study is to investigate the efficacy, safety and tolerability of BI 10773 (10 and 25 mg once daily) compared to placebo and sitagliptin (100 mg once daily) given for 24 weeks as monotherapy in patients with T2DM with insufficient glycaemic control.
For the open-label part of the study the objective is to estimate the efficacy and safety of BI 10773 when given for 24 weeks in patients with T2DM with very poor glycaemic control. |

E.3 | Principal inclusion criteria |
1. Diagnosis of type 2 diabetes mellitus prior to informed consent
2. Male and female patients on diet and exercise regimen who are drug-naïve, defined as absence of any oral or injectable anti-diabetes therapy for 12 weeks prior to randomisation or start of active open-label treatment (25 mg BI 10773)
3. HbA1c
- ≥ 7.0% and <= 10.0% at Visit 1 (screening) in order to be eligible for randomised treatment
- > 10.0% at visit 1 (screening) in order to be eligible for the open-label BI 10773 arm
4. Age >= 20 (Japan)
Age >= 18 (countries other than Japan)
5. BMI <= 45 kg/m2 (Body Mass Index) at Visit 1 (screening)
6. Signed and dated written informed consent by date of Visit 1 in accordance with GCP and local legislation

E.4 | Principal exclusion criteria |
1. Uncontrolled hyperglycaemia with a glucose level >240 mg/dl (>13.3 mmol/L) after an overnight fast during placebo run-in and confirmed by a second measurement (not on the same day).
2. Myocardial infarction, stroke or TIA within 3 months prior to informed consent
3. Indication of liver disease, defined by serum levels of either ALT (SGPT), AST (SGOT), or alkaline phosphatase above 3 x upper limit of normal (ULN) during screening and/or run-in phase
4. Impaired renal function, defined as eGFR<50 ml/min (moderate to severe renal impairment; MDRD formula)
5. Bariatric surgery within the past two years and other gastrointestinal surgeries that induce chronic malabsorption
6. Medical history of cancer (except for basal cell carcinoma) and/or treatment for cancer within the last 5 years
7. Contraindications to sitagliptin according to the local label
8. Blood dyscrasias or any disorders causing haemolysis or unstable Red Blood Cell (e.g. malaria, babesiosis, haemolytic anaemia)
9. Treatment with any anti-diabetes drug within 12 weeks prior to randomisation or start of active open-label treatment (25 mg BI 10773)
10. Treatment with anti-obesity drugs (e.g. sibutramine, orlistat) 3 months prior to informed consent or any other treatment at the time of screening (i.e. surgery, aggressive diet regimen, etc.) leading to unstable body weight
11. Current treatment with systemic steroids at time of informed consent or change in dosage of thyroid hormones within 6 weeks prior to informed consent or any other uncontrolled endocrine disorder except T2DM.
12. Pre-menopausal women (last menstruation <= 1 year prior to informed consent) who:
- are nursing or pregnant or
- are of child-bearing potential and are not practicing an acceptable method of birth control, or do not plan to continue using this method throughout the study and do not agree to submit to periodic pregnancy testing during participation in the trial. Acceptable methods of birth control include tubal ligation, transdermal patch, intra uterine devices/systems (IUDs/IUSs), oral, implantable or injectable contraceptives, sexual abstinence (if acceptable by local authorities), double barrier method and vasectomised partner
13. Alcohol or drug abuse within the 3 months prior to informed consent that would interfere with trial participation or any ongoing condition leading to a decreased compliance to study procedures or study drug intake
14. Participation in another trial with an investigational drug within 30 days prior to informed consent
15. Any other clinical condition that would jeopardize patients safety while participating in this clinical trial

E.5 End points |
E.5.1 | Primary end point(s) |
The primary endpoint in this study is the change from baseline in HbA1c after 24 weeks of treatment (%). Throughout the study protocol, the term "baseline" refers to the last observation prior to the administration of any (open-label 25 mg BI 10773 or randomised) study medication. |
